What do you give a child with ADD?
For most children, stimulant medications are a safe and effective way to relieve ADHD symptoms. As glasses help people focus their eyes to see, these medications help children with ADHD focus their thoughts better and ignore distractions. This makes them more able to pay attention and control their behavior.
Can add be cured in children?
ADHD is the most commonly diagnosed mental disorder in children. Boys are more likely to have it than girls. It’s usually spotted during the early school years, when a child begins to have problems paying attention. ADHD can’t be prevented or cured.

What vitamins are good for children with ADD?
Vitamin B & C Finally, supplementing vitamins B and C can also help alleviate ADD and ADHD symptoms. Vitamin C, like zinc, iron, and magnesium, is used to produce neurotransmitters like dopamine. Additionally, vitamin B deficiency is linked to irritability and fatigue in children.
What deficiency causes ADD?
Research shows that people with ADHD tend to have low levels of dopamine in the brain. Some researchers suggest that iron deficiency may, therefore, play a role in ADHD. A 2018 review looked at 17 studies comparing iron levels in children with and without ADHD.

Is ashwagandha good for ADHD?
Some clinical research shows that taking ashwagandha can reduce some symptoms of anxiety or anxious mood. Attention deficit-hyperactivity disorder (ADHD). Some clinical research shows that a combination herbal product containing ashwagandha may improve attention and impulse control in children with ADHD.
